The Gift of Peace 

John 14: 27

 

John

Jesus said, "I am leaving you with a gift - peace of mind and heart.  And the peace I give isn't like the peace the world gives.  So don't be troubled or afraid."  

 

*** 

 

Thoughts.....

 

I remember this text best from the King James Version having learned it as a child.  It reads "Peace I leave with you, my peace I give unto you:  not as the world giveth, give I unto you.  Let not your heart be troubled, neither let it be afraid." 

 Paul tells us in Romans 5:1-2:

"Therefore, since we have been made right in God's sight by faith, we have peace with God because of what Jesus Christ our Lord has done for us.  Because of our faith, Christ has brought us into this place of highest privilege where we now stand, and we confidently and joyfully look forward to sharing God's glory."

This place of highest privilege is peace with God.....

Is this our faith in God or God's faith in us?  Both.

Paul tells us in Roman's 12: 1-2:

"And so, dear brothers and sisters, I plead with you to give your bodies to God.  Let them be a living and holy sacrifice - the kind he will accept. When you think of what he has done for you, is it too much to ask?  Don't copy the behavior and customs of this world, but let God transform you into a new person by changing the way you think.  Then you will know what God wants you to do, and you will know how good and pleasing and perfect his will really is."   

Paul now tells us in Ephesians 6:10-18:

"Be strong with the Lord's mighty power.  Put on all of God's armor so that you will be able to stand firm against all strategies and tricks of the Devil.  For we are not fighting against people made of flesh and blood, but against the evil rulers and authorities of the unseen world, against those mighty powers of darkness who rule this world, and against wicked spirits in the heavenly realms. [Wicked spirits in the heavenly realms ???!!!] 

"Use every piece of God's armor to resist the enemy in the time of evil, so that after the battle you will still be standing firm.  Stand your ground, putting on the sturdy belt of truth and the body of armor of God's righteousness.  For shoes, put on the peace that comes from the Good News so that you will be fully prepared.  In every battle you will need faith as your shield to stop the fiery arrows aimed at you by Satan.  Put on salvation as your helmet, and take the sword of the Spirit which is the word of God.  Pray at all times and on every occasion in the power of the Holy Spirit.  Stay alert and be persistent in your prayers for all Christians everywhere."

In Ephesians 4:1-2 Paul compels us:

"Therefore I, a prisoner for serving the Lord, beg you to lead a life worthy of your calling, for you have been called by God.  Be humble and gentle.  Be patient with each other, making allowance for each other's faults because of your love[for God and each other as we are commanded to do].  Always keep yourselves united in the Holy Spirit, and bind yourselves together with peace."

The letter to the Galatians...and to us....spells out clearly the fruits given from the Holy Spirit to help us do this in verse 5:22: 

"But when the Holy Spirit controls our lives, he will produce this kind of fruit in us:  love, joy, peace, patience, kindness, goodness, faithfulness, gentleness, and self-control."  

Per the letter to the Galatians 6:15b-16: 

"What counts is whether we really have been changed into new and different people.  May God's mercy and peace be upon all those who live by this principle.  They are the new people of God."  [Amen and Alleluia!]

So....

"Don't worry about anything, instead pray about everything.  Tell God what you need, and thank him for all he has done.  If you do this, you will experience God's peace, which is far more wonderful than the human mind can understand.  His peace will guard your hearts and minds as you live in Christ Jesus. 

And now, dear brothers and sisters, let me say one more thing as I close this letter.  Fix your thoughts on what is true and honorable and right.  Think about things that are pure and lovely and admirable. Think about things that are excellent and worthy of praise.  Keep putting into practice all you learned from me and heard from me and saw me doing, and the God of peace will be with you."  From Paul...in the letter to the Philippians 4:6-9         

Ahhhhh....."...the peace of God, which passeth all understanding..."  KJV.
